4. Offering Virtual Assistance Services

Virtual assisting is a great option if you have strong administrative or organizational skills. As a virtual assistant, you can help businesses and individuals manage their schedules, emails, bookkeeping, and more. You can offer your services on freelance platforms like Upwork or Fiverr, or reach out directly to businesses in need of virtual assistance.

13. Pet Sitting Business

If you love animals and have experience taking care of pets, starting a pet sitting business can be a fulfilling and flexible option. You can offer services such as dog walking, feeding, or house sitting for pet owners who need someone to care for their pets while they are away.

Tip: Advertise your services on pet-sitting websites or through social media, and make sure to obtain appropriate licenses and insurance before starting your business.

Managing Work-Life Balance as a Mompreneur

One of the biggest challenges for stay-at-home mom entrepreneurs is managing work-life balance. With the demands of raising children and running a business, it can be hard to find time for everything.

First, it’s important to establish clear boundaries between work and family time. Set specific work hours and stick to them, and communicate these boundaries to family members and clients. Avoid multi-tasking during family time, and give your undivided attention to your family.

Second, involve your family in your business. Assign age-appropriate tasks to your children, such as helping with packaging or social media. This not only helps you with your workload, but also teaches your children valuable skills and gives them a sense of ownership in your business.

Third, consider side business ideas that require less time commitment. If you find that your current business is taking too much time away from your family, consider adding a side business that can be managed more easily. This could be something as simple as selling products on Etsy or offering website design services on a part-time basis.

Remember, achieving work-life balance is an ongoing process that requires flexibility and adaptability. Don’t be afraid to adjust your schedule or business as needed to make sure that you are meeting the needs of both your family and your business.

Financial Considerations for Stay-at-Home Mom Businesses

Starting a business as a stay-at-home mom can be an empowering and lucrative endeavor, but it’s important to consider the financial aspects of entrepreneurship. Here are some financial considerations to keep in mind:

  • Budgeting: Prior to launching your business, create a budget that accounts for startup costs such as equipment, supplies, and legal fees. Also, factor in ongoing expenses such as website hosting, marketing, and inventory.
  • Tracking Expenses: Keep track of all business-related expenses to ensure accurate bookkeeping and to make tax time less stressful. Use accounting software or spreadsheets to record transactions.
  • Saving for Taxes: As a business owner, you may be required to pay self-employment taxes, which can add up quickly. Set aside a percentage of your income each month specifically for taxes.
  • Cash Flow Management: Monitor your cash flow regularly to ensure that you have enough money to cover expenses and make a profit. Consider implementing payment systems that provide predictable cash flow, such as retainer agreements or subscriptions.
  • Seeking Funding: If you need financial assistance to start your business, consider applying for small business grants or loans. However, be cautious about taking on debt and ensure that you have a plan for repayment.
